[QUOTE="CaptHenway, post: 362405, member: 13813"]I was fascinated by the addition to the myth surrounding the Yoachum dollars of the fanciful story that the silver used in them had been mined by Spanish conquistadors in 1541, only to be left behind and re-discovered by native Americans circa 1820. As a professional authenticator I examined, in 1982, two of the eight pieces allegedly discovered in a cave in the early 1980s. At that time the story that accompanied them was that they had been made in 1822 by a trader named Yoachum from native silver ore mined by Indians in the Ozarks. We did x-ray tests on the pieces and discovered that they were nearly perfect sterling silver, 92.5% pure silver and 7.5% pure copper with virtually no trace elements. It is what you would expect if somebody melted down a few sterling silver spoons or forks. It is impossible from raw ore crudely smelted, by either Indians or conquistadors. We returned the coins as "No Decision," with the comment that we would like to see one from a different source. About six months later we received one from a party in Indiana who claimed that it was an old family heirloom. A check of our photographic and weight records proved that it was merely one of the original two pieces, now heavily artificially toned. In my personal opinion the pieces I examined in 1982 and 1983 are modern fantasies. I also understand that imitations of them are being sold in the gift shop at Silver Dollar City in Branson, MO. Whether or not the 1982 pieces had any connection to Silver Dollar City would be sheer speculation, unless someone other than I has any knowledge of this and would care to add to this discussion.
